The invention discloses a VTS (vessel traffic service) system based on RPR (resilient packet ring) technology. The VTS system comprises a radar, a closed-circuit television monitoring system, a VHF (very high frequency) communication station, an automatic vessel identification system base station, a radio direction finder, a sonar, a processing computer, a display control computer and a server. The radar, the closed-circuit television monitoring system, the VHF communication station, the automatic vessel identification system base station, the radio direction finder, the sonar, the processing computer, the display control computer and the server are connected to the VTS system through RPR nodes, so that the VTS system is integrated with IP intelligence, Ethernet economy, and high bandwidth efficiency and reliability of an optical fiber ring network.
